A vibrant cold pasta salad with tender vegetables like asparagus and peas, fresh herbs, and a creamy green goddess dressing. Light and refreshing, it's a perfect summer side or light main.

Ingredients

serves 8
  • 16 Ounces Pasta Shells (small or medium)
  • 1 Cup Frozen Peas
  • 12 Asparagus Spears (chopped in 1/2" pieces)
  • 1 Bunch Green Onions (chopped)
  • 1 Avocado (chopped small)
  • 1 Cup Baby Spinach
  • 1 Cup Fresh Basil
  • 2 Cloves Garlic
  • 1 Shallot (small)
  • 1 Lemon (zested)
  • 2 Lemons (juiced)
  • ¼ Cup Olive Oil
  • ¼ Cup Cashews (roasted and salted, see note)
  • ⅓ Cup Parmesan Cheese (grated)
  • 2 Tablespoons Rice Vinegar
